ATM
227 E Main St
Elbridge, NY 13060
American Express offers a robust network tailored to enhance the payment landscape for various partners, including Issuers, Acquirers, and Fintechs. With a focus on high-spending customers and cutting-edge payment solutions, American Express empowers businesses to grow and connect seamlessly with their clientele.
The company also provides cardholders exclusive perks and benefits, making it easier for them to enjoy unique experiences. Through innovative platforms and services, American Express solidifies its position as a leader in the payments industry, supporting merchants and cardholders alike.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.

